April 2018 inflation data
The UK’s main inflation measure falls to 2.4%, its lowest level since March 2017.
The inflation measures for the year to April 2018 are as follows:
- CPI inflation was 2.4% in April (Index: 105.4), down from 2.5% in the year to March
- CPIH inflation was 2.2% in April (Index: 105.5), down from 2.3% in the year to March
- RPI inflation was 3.4% in April (Index: 279.7), up from 3.3% in the year to March
The CPIH measure is the Office of National Statistic’s preferred index, see ‘New inflation measure’.
